Rising Cardiovascular Disease Burden Driving Cholesterol esterase Market Expansion

The Cholesterol esterase Market is fundamentally driven by the increasing prevalence of cardiovascular diseases, which continues to expand the global diagnostic testing base. For instance, lipid profile testing volumes are projected to grow at 7%–8% annually through 2026, directly influencing enzyme consumption.

Cholesterol esterase is essential in enzymatic assays for cholesterol quantification, where it catalyzes the hydrolysis of cholesterol esters into free cholesterol. As preventive healthcare adoption increases, screening programs are expanding across both developed and emerging economies. For example, national health initiatives in Asia and Europe are targeting screening coverage increases of 15%–20% by 2026.

Such as in urban populations, where sedentary lifestyles are contributing to a 12%–18% rise in hyperlipidemia prevalence, diagnostic demand is scaling proportionally. This directly translates into increased procurement of enzymatic reagents, reinforcing growth in the Cholesterol esterase Market.

Growth in Pharmaceutical and Biotech Research Supporting Cholesterol esterase Market Diversification

Beyond diagnostics, the Cholesterol esterase Market is expanding into pharmaceutical and biotechnology research applications. Cholesterol esterase is increasingly used in studies related to lipid metabolism, drug delivery systems, and enzyme kinetics.

For instance, pharmaceutical R&D spending is projected to grow at 6%–8% annually through 2026, with enzyme-based studies forming a critical component of drug development pipelines. Cholesterol esterase is used to simulate lipid digestion processes, enabling researchers to evaluate drug solubility and bioavailability.

Such as in the development of lipid-based drug formulations, cholesterol esterase is used to assess enzymatic breakdown, which directly impacts therapeutic efficacy. This application segment is growing at over 10% CAGR, making it one of the fastest-expanding areas within the Cholesterol esterase Market.

Additionally, academic research institutions are increasing funding for metabolic disorder studies, further contributing to enzyme demand.

Cholesterol esterase Market Key Manufacturers and Product Positioning

The Cholesterol esterase Market includes a mix of multinational corporations and niche enzyme specialists, each targeting specific application segments.

Amano Enzyme Inc. is a prominent manufacturer focusing on microbial-derived cholesterol esterase with high activity levels. Its enzyme variants are widely used in clinical chemistry analyzers, particularly in Asia-Pacific where cost-performance balance is critical.

  1. Hoffmann-La Roche Ltd. holds a strong position in the Cholesterol esterase Market through its integration of cholesterol esterase into automated diagnostic kits. Its product lines emphasize high specificity and minimal interference, making them suitable for large-scale hospital laboratories.

FUJIFILM Wako Pure Chemical Corporation provides both research-grade and diagnostic-grade cholesterol esterase, with standardized enzyme activity units. Its offerings are widely used in academic research and industrial applications requiring consistent enzyme performance.

Creative Enzymes focuses on customized recombinant cholesterol esterase solutions tailored for pharmaceutical and biotechnology applications. For instance, its enzyme variants are optimized for lipid metabolism studies and drug formulation testing.

Nagase Diagnostics Co., Ltd. differentiates itself with specialized product lines such as CENⅡ and CEBPⅡ, designed for targeted lipid assays including HDL and LDL measurements. These products are widely adopted in clinical diagnostics requiring high precision.

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c. leverages its global distribution network and advanced enzyme engineering capabilities to supply cholesterol esterase across both diagnostic and research segments. Its products are often integrated into broader biochemical assay systems.

Merck KGaA offers high-purity cholesterol esterase for research and diagnostic use, focusing on stringent quality standards and regulatory compliance. Its enzyme solutions are commonly used in pharmaceutical laboratories.

Sekisui Diagnostics provides enzyme-based diagnostic reagents, including cholesterol testing kits incorporating cholesterol esterase. Its strength lies in integrated solutions rather than standalone enzyme sales.

Advanced Enzymes Technologies is an emerging player in the Cholesterol esterase Market, expanding its production capacity and export footprint. The company focuses on cost-efficient manufacturing and large-scale supply.
